- The electric guitar on the heavy metal guy’s back has turned into a shamisen. The shamisen is a Japanese instrument made from cat skin. Historically, cat skin was chosen because it is thin, vibrates well, and produces a delicate, lustrous tone. However, in recent years, due to animal welfare concerns and durability, synthetic leather and washi paper are being used as alternatives.
